Transaction eda85914585278de5d8fb3ad576c24f1eb94364a71417a9c7f915a8dfd4cc08e
1 Input
1 Output
-
eda85914585278de5d8fb3ad576c24f1eb94364a71417a9c7f915a8dfd4cc08e:0
- value
- 317344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 203d69deba208e3ab1c40396d16cd192192f3048 OP_EQUAL
- address
- 34dV7mfdh8rSkEsf4Q2NkBB2pL3LtdZ6xy